## Identifying the Essentials and Inventory Management

Every business has unique needs when it comes to office supplies. While some offices might require more extravagant materials, others might only require the bare necessities. Identifying what your office needs regularly can help formulate a list of essential stationery.

An integral part of this process is inventory management. Overstocking can lead to wastage and inefficiency as goods may degrade or get lost over time. Understocking leads to work interruptions as employees wait for supplies. The aim should be to have a smooth supply of what you need when you need it, without having excess.

### Leveraging Technology

Using technology in stationery management could help offices maximize efficiency. Inventory management systems can provide real-time insights into what’s in stock and what’s running low and can thus help in automating the process. The technology reduces human errors, makes the delays almost obsolete, and cuts cost significantly.

These systems often provide analytics, allowing managers to gain insights into usage patterns and spend. They can help identify any areas of unnecessary duplicate spending and promote better procurement processes with evidence-backed decision making.

## Minimizing Waste

An efficient strategy in minimizing stationery wastage is implementing a policy of “Think Before You Print”. Encouraging employees to think twice before printing can result in a significant reduction in paper and ink waste. Additionally, adopting a recycling policy for used paper, empty ink cartridges, and other reusable items can also lead to cost savings.

### Buying in Bulk and Vendor Relationships

Purchasing stationery in bulk helps reduce the overall cost per unit, especially for items used widely across the office such as paper, pens, and sticky notes. However, purchasing in bulk should only apply to items that have a longer shelf life to avoid wastage and cluttering of storage space.

Developing a good relationship with suppliers may also contribute significantly towards office efficiency. Suppliers can often provide insights into usage patterns and might be able to recommend cheaper alternatives. In some circumstances, they might also be willing to provide a “just-in-time” service that delivers items as they are needed.

## Training and Policies

To maximize efficiency, employees should be trained on the importance of stationery management. Training ensures everyone understands the procurement process, the appropriate use of office supplies, and waste reduction measures.

Implementing stationery-use policies can further set guidelines on how stationery should be used. These guidelines discourage unnecessary usage and waste while promoting sustainable practices. Also, it’s crucial to have accountability measures in place to ensure everyone adheres to these policies.
